Unity 引擎课程可以帮助您学习游戏设计原理、三维建模、动画技术和使用 C# 编写脚本。您可以掌握创建交互式环境、优化性能和实现物理模拟的技能。许多课程都会介绍一些工具,如用于采购资产的 Unity Asset Store、用于编码的 Visual Studio 以及用于协作项目的 Version Control System,让您可以在实际的游戏开发场景中应用所学知识。

Michigan State University
您将获得的技能: 叙事, 同行评审, 三维资产, 视频游戏开发, 软件文档, 动画和游戏设计, 用户界面(UI), 概念设计, 多媒体, 原型设计, 用户体验设计, 软件设计, Unity 引擎, 游戏设计, 三维建模, 跨平台开发, C#(编程语言), 软件设计文件, 构思, 计算机图形学
初级 · 专项课程 · 3-6 个月

University of Colorado System
您将获得的技能: 计算机编程, 数据结构, 图论, 事件驱动编程, 调试, 面向对象设计, 视频游戏开发, 数据管理, 数据存储, 原型设计, 编程原则, 游戏设计, 应用程序开发, 文件输入/输出, Algorithm, 面向对象编程(OOP), 软件架构, C#(编程语言), Unity 引擎, 软件设计模式
初级 · 专项课程 · 3-6 个月

您将获得的技能: Unity Engine, Animations, Visualization (Computer Graphics), 3D Assets, Software Design Patterns, Video Game Development, Object Oriented Programming (OOP), Application Performance Management, Data-oriented programming, Game Design, Virtual Environment, Software Development Tools, Virtual Reality, Computer Graphics, Performance Tuning, Data Validation, Real Time Data, Computer Graphic Techniques, Scripting, C# (Programming Language)
中级 · 专项课程 · 3-6 个月

University of Colorado System
您将获得的技能: 计算机编程, 调试, 视频游戏开发, 数据存储, 用户界面(UI), 脚本, 开发环境, 面向对象编程(OOP), 游戏设计, C#(编程语言), Unity 引擎
初级 · 课程 · 1-4 周

您将获得的技能: 3D Modeling, Integration Testing, Programming Principles, Data Structures, Computer Programming
中级 · 专项课程 · 1-3 个月

您将获得的技能: Unity Engine, Game Design, Animation and Game Design, Video Game Development, Animations, Scripting, Software Architecture, Augmented and Virtual Reality (AR/VR), Interactive Design, Development Environment, Object Oriented Design, C# (Programming Language), Object Oriented Programming (OOP), UI Components, 3D Assets, Virtual Environment, User Interface (UI), Artificial Intelligence, Software Development Tools, Debugging
初级 · 专项课程 · 1-3 个月

您将获得的技能: Unreal Engine, Video Game Development, Animation and Game Design, Game Design, Animations, User Interface (UI), Prototyping, Virtual Environment, Virtual Reality, Visualization (Computer Graphics), Simulations, Artificial Intelligence, User Interface (UI) Design, Augmented and Virtual Reality (AR/VR), Debugging
中级 · 专项课程 · 3-6 个月

您将获得的技能: Animation and Game Design, Unity Engine, Game Design, 3D Assets, User Interface (UI), Computer Graphics, 3D Modeling, Virtual Environment, Video Game Development, User Interface (UI) Design, Computer Graphic Techniques, Visualization (Computer Graphics), User Interface and User Experience (UI/UX) Design, Color Theory, Performance Tuning, Frontend Performance, Geospatial Mapping, C# (Programming Language), Scripting, Data Persistence
中级 · 专项课程 · 3-6 个月

您将获得的技能: Unity Engine, Video Game Development, Game Design, C# (Programming Language), Artificial Intelligence, Scripting, UI Components, Animations
混合 · 课程 · 1-4 周

您将获得的技能: Unity Engine, UI Components, Scripting, User Interface (UI), Torque (Physics), Responsive Web Design, User Interface (UI) Design, Object Oriented Programming (OOP), C# (Programming Language), Game Design, Animation and Game Design, Animations, Interactive Design, Usability, Video Game Development, Mechanics, Simulations, Mathematical Modeling, Physics, Debugging
初级 · 专项课程 · 1-3 个月

您将获得的技能: Unity Engine, Game Design, Video Game Development, Performance Tuning, User Interface (UI), Animation and Game Design, 3D Assets, Event-Driven Programming, Virtual Environment, UI Components, C# (Programming Language), Program Development, Debugging, Object Oriented Programming (OOP), System Configuration, User Interface (UI) Design, Object Oriented Design, Scripting, Prototyping, Animations
初级 · 专项课程 · 3-6 个月

您将获得的技能: 3D Modeling, 3D Assets, Unreal Engine, Computer Graphics, Computer Graphic Techniques, Animation and Game Design, Graphical Tools, Virtual Environment, Data Import/Export, Image Quality, Performance Tuning, Content Management
初级 · 专项课程 · 3-6 个月
Unity Engine 是一个功能强大的游戏开发平台,能让创作者在移动、桌面和游戏机等各种平台上构建互动体验。它的重要性在于其多功能性和用户友好的 Interface,使初学者和经验丰富的开发人员都能使用。Unity 支持 2D 和 3D 图形、物理和脚本,允许创建游戏以外的各种应用,如模拟和虚拟现实体验。
掌握 Unity 引擎技能后,您可以从事各种职业,包括游戏开发人员、软件工程师、三维艺术家和 Interaction Design 设计师。随着游戏行业的不断发展,以及教育和培训等利用游戏化的行业的发展,这些职位的需求量很大。此外,随着技术的发展,AR/VR 开发人员和技术艺术家等职位也在不断涌现,为那些熟练掌握 Unity 的人提供了令人兴奋的机会。
学习Unity引擎有许多在线课程。其中一些最佳选择包括涵盖游戏开发各个方面的专项课程。虽然这里没有列出具体的 Unity 课程,但通过探索 Coursera 等平台,您可以找到适合自己兴趣和技能水平的综合学习路径。寻找提供实践项目和实际应用的课程,以增强您的学习体验。
是的,您可以通过两种方式在 Coursera 上免费开始学习 unity engine:
如果您想继续学习、获得统一引擎证书或在预览或试用后解锁全部课程访问权限,可以升级或申请经济援助。
要学习 Unity 引擎,首先要通过教程和在线课程熟悉界面和基本功能。通过创建小项目参与动手实践,这将有助于加强学习。加入在线社区和论坛可以从其他学习者那里获得支持和 Feedback。坚持不懈地练习和探索 Unity 的各种 Feature 将逐步提高您的技能。
要对员工进行 Unity Engine 培训和技能提升,应选择强调实际应用和基于项目学习的课程。以合作项目为重点的课程可以提高团队合作技能,同时培养专业技术能力。考虑提供行业最佳实践和新兴趋势见解的课程,以确保您的员工在不断变化的游戏开发环境中保持竞争力。